Which reactions are called exothermic and which are endothermic? How is the thermal effect of a reaction denoted in thermochemical equations? What reactions, exothermic or endothermic, are usually combustion and thermal decomposition reactions of salts?

Reactions with the release of heat are called exothermic (combustion reactions), with heat absorption – endothermic (salt decomposition reactions).
The heat effect of the reaction in thermochemical equations is denoted by the letter Q.
